Superintendent Hoppstock receives top score by Berrien RESA Board

During Monday’s Board of Education meeting, the Board completed its annual review of the district’s Superintendent, Eric Hoppstock. He received an “effective” evaluation - the highest level possible, resulting in an extension of his contract by one year. Mr. Hoppstock will continue to serve the district through June 30, 2029.

"The Board is immensely proud to award Superintendent Eric Hoppstock an 'effective' evaluation—the highest rating possible in our rubric,” said Berrien RESA Board President Jackie Van Horn. “Eric continues to lead Berrien RESA with a focus on innovation and inclusivity. He has an exceptional ability to take strong operations and find meaningful ways to elevate them even further. His calm demeanor and genuine commitment to active listening ensure our staff, students, and constituent districts consistently feel supported. Leading with a proactive mindset, he is always looking for ways to improve, ensuring student success remains at the forefront of every decision.”

Van Horn noted that Hoppstock’s leadership extends far beyond internal programs. “The continuous wave of positive feedback we receive from the community is a true testament to his outstanding impact on our region,” she said. “From championing state and federal legislative initiatives to partnering with local businesses to create unique career pathways, Eric’s influence is evident across the entire educational landscape.”

For 39 years, Superintendent Hoppstock has provided education services to schools and students across Berrien County. Beginning his career at Berrien RESA in 1987, Hoppstock was a school psychologist, went on to become the Supervisor of the Special Education Department, and then the district’s Assistant Superintendent and Chief Academic Officer.
